My v9 server backups nightly to a locally connected USB drive of 3TB capacity.
Fdisk -l reports the size as 3TB.
Disk /dev/sdb: 3000.6 GB, 3000592977920 bytes
255 heads, 63 sectors/track, 45600 cylinders
Units = cylinders of 16065 * 4096 = 65802240 bytes
Sector size (logical/physical): 4096 bytes / 4096 bytes
I/O size (minimum/optimal): 4096 bytes / 4096 bytes
Disk identifier: 0xee42fb5f
DAR reports:
Destination disk usage 330G, 48% full, 368G available
Backup successfully terminated at Sun May 31 02:12:41 2015
This suggests to me that DAR is only seeing around 700GB of a 3TB disc.
I have searched but can find no mention of a destination size limit (doesn't mean there is no such post of course) anyone have any answers?
